In this work, an iterative learning control scheme is designed for a class of nonlinear uncertain systems with input saturation. The analysis of convergence in the iteration domain is based on composite energy function, which consists of both input and state information along the time and iteration axes. Through rigorous analysis, the learning convergence in the iteration domain can be guaranteed under the input saturation, provided the desired trajectory is realizable within the saturation bound.
